What does a medical journal editor do?

A Medical Journal Editor oversees the publication process of medical research articles, ensuring accuracy, clarity, and adherence to ethical guidelines. They manage peer review, select articles for publication, and collaborate with authors, reviewers, and publishers. Editors also ensure that content meets scientific and editorial standards while staying up-to-date with advancements in medical research.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a medical journal editor?

To thrive as a Medical Journal Editor, you need a strong background in medical or scientific research, excellent command of written English, and solid editorial experience—often supported by an advanced degree in a health-related field. Familiarity with manuscript submission systems (such as ScholarOne or Editorial Manager), biomedical databases, and reference management tools is highly beneficial. Outstanding attention to detail, organizational skills, and the ability to provide constructive feedback are valuable soft skills in this role. These qualifications ensure the integrity and clarity of published research, uphold journal standards, and facilitate efficient editorial workflows.

How to become a medical journal editor?

To become a medical journal editor, candidates typically need a medical or scientific degree, such as an MD or PhD, along with experience in research, writing, or peer review. Strong editing skills, knowledge of medical publishing standards, and familiarity with manuscript management tools are also important. Many editors advance from roles such as associate editors or reviewers within academic or medical publishing environments.
